The Role

The Senior Treasury Manager will play a key role in safeguarding and optimising City Football Group’s liquidity, funding and financial risk management. You will work closely with Treasury colleagues, Senior Finance leaders, internal teams and external partners to ensure strong cash visibility, disciplined risk management and robust treasury governance across the Group.

Your Impact
  • Manage the day-to-day cash management and liquidity needs of the Group and deliver clear, insightful cash flow forecasting analysis.
  • Proactively manage foreign exchange, interest rate and counter party risk exposures, devising and utilising appropriate risk mitigation strategies and coordinating with Finance colleagues on IFRS derivative accounting entries and queries.
  • Work closely with the Head of Treasury in the development and execution of the Group funding strategy, including banking facilities and the management of banks, investors and credit rating agencies. Oversee the covenant compliance process and associated reporting.
  • Identify and drive continuous improvement in treasury controls, processes and systems, including the use of automation and emerging technologies to enhance insight, efficiency and decision‑making.
  • Act as a trusted Treasury partner and advisor to clubs and internal teams across the City Football Group network, providing guidance, support and challenge on treasury‑related matters.
What we are looking for
  • Bachelor’s degree or qualified by experience.
  • Professional qualification such as ACT (Association of Corporate Treasurers), ACCA, ACA, CIM or equivalent
  • Multi‑year experience working in a multinational, multi‑entity Corporate Treasury environment.
  • Proven experience in developing and executing financial risk management strategies, including foreign exchange, cash investment, interest rate and counter party risk.
  • Strong experience of producing and analysing cash flow forecasts (direct and indirect methodologies).
  • Experience on managing debt facilities or debt instruments, including associated reporting requirements and covenant compliance.
  • Sound knowledge of IFRS derivative accounting including applying hedge accounting.
  • Comfortable operating in a fast‑paced, high‑profile environment with competing priorities.
  • Manage bank, investor and credit rating agency relationships.
  • Experience of using, selecting or implementing a Treasury Management System and experience leveraging automation, data and analytics to improve processes, controls and insight.
  • Advanced level of Microsoft Excel and Power BI modelling.
  • Experience developing and mentoring Treasury colleagues.
